The   YN   Zone

The YN ZONE is open to all Young Numismatists (young coin collectors) up to 18 years of age.  The YN ZONE is a self paced and supervised activity that is designed to educate young collectors on various aspects of the coin collecting hobby.  The YN ZONE in addition to teaching the young collector about the hobby, rewards them with prizes such as collectable coins, numismatic books, and coin supplies.  The average young collector should be able to complete these activities in about 1-1.5 hours.

The YN ZONE works by giving the young collector the opportunity to earn YN credits for each activity.  Each young collector can earn up to $15.00 worth of YN credits that can be exchanged for prizes.   All prizes have been donated by the NCNA and sponsoring coin dealers.

Parents are welcome and encouraged to participate with their young collectors.

The YN ZONE will be open Saturday (10am-4pm) and Sunday (10am-3pm).

This year's NCNA Convention is again being held at the Hickory Metro Convention Center in Hickory, North Carolina. This will be the seventh year that we have chosen to hold our annual Convention and Coin Show in the expansive Hickory Metro Convention Center. It was chosen for its ease of access from both Interstate 40 and Interstate 77 and has proven to be an excellent venue for numismatics. Thus we have again secured a 12,800-square-foot Exhibit Hall for this year’s convention and show and invite all to come and enjoy three days of collecting fun with us. Through the Hickory Metro Convention Center we continue to offer a modern, large, and well-lit bourse area in which to conduct your business or view the educational exhibits. There are amble meeting rooms for our scheduled educational presentations and our organization's annual meeting and awards banquet. There are excellent public facilities to make this an enjoyable and hassle free convention again this year. Plus, there are also plenty of hotel accommodations and restaurants in the area to serve the traveling collector.
